A Tapestry of Tradition: The Suzani Jacket
The Suzani jacket, a timeless masterpiece from Central Asia, embodies centuries of refined tradition. Stitched with intricate patterns that tell stories of love, life, and the natural world, each jacket is a unique work of art. The vibrant shades used in the embroidery often symbolize elements of nature, such as flowers, while geometric structures add to the intricacy of the design.
These jackets were originally fashioned by women as a sign of their status and craftsmanship. Today, the Suzani jacket continues to be valued for its aesthetic, serving as a testament to the enduring power of traditional craftsmanship.
From Uzbekistan to Your Closet: Styling a Suzani Jacket
A eye-catching click here suzani jacket is more than just a garment; it's a work of art, steeped in the rich cultural heritage of Uzbekistan. These jackets, classically crafted with intricate embroidery and vivid colors, now offer a unique way to infuse your wardrobe with global flair.
To effortlessly incorporate a suzani jacket into your look, consider complementing its complex patterns with simpler pieces. A pair of straight-leg jeans or a flowy skirt can create a harmonious ensemble.
Experiment with different styling choices. Layer your suzani jacket over a tailored turtleneck for a chic, autumnal vibe, or pair it with bright accessories to create a eye-catching statement.
When choosing shoes, select footwear that complements the jacket's vibrancy. Ankle boots can add a touch of modernity, while slip-ons offer a more casual look.

The Tapestry Traditions of Suzani
From traditional heartlands of Central Asia, the art of Suzani stitchcraft flourishes as a vibrant testament to textile heritage. Each intricate design tells a story, woven with colorful threads and imbued with cultural significance. Skilled artisans meticulously craft these exquisite works of art, transforming simple fabric into masterpieces that embody the spirit of their inherited traditions.

The delicate embroidery often depicts floral motifs, geometric patterns, and stylized birds. These emblems hold symbolic meaning, reflecting the beliefs and aspirations of the people. Suzani stitchcraft is not merely a craft; it is a living tradition passed down through generations, connecting the past to the present.
